ZIP 92122 and ZIP 92123 are ZIP Code areas in California.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 92122 has the higher population (45,437 vs 32,999 in ZIP 92123). ZIP 92123 has the higher median household income ($121,856 vs $98,825 in ZIP 92122). ZIP 92122 has the higher median home value ($1,005,000 vs $799,600 in ZIP 92123).
